Le280m Theft At Guaranty Trust Bank… 4 Arraigned

By Janet A Sesay

Four staff at Guarantee Trust Bank at Lunsar branch Habib Kargbo, Yusuf Daramy, Lamin Kamara and John Kanu have been brought before a magistrate court in Freetown for larceny involving Le280m.

They were also similarly charged with conspiracy to commit larceny.

The accused persons made their first appearance last Friday before Magistrate Sahr Kekura of Pademba Road court.

Police alleged that the accused, on Tuesday 2nd  January,  2024 at Lunsar branch, conspired to  defraud Guarantee Trust Bank (GTB)  Sierra Leone Limited of Le280m.

The accused pleaded not guilty after the charges were read and explained to them, and defence counsel made an application for bail on behalf of the accused persons which was granted.

The matter will come up again on 13th February, and Assistant Superintendent of police Ibrahim Mansaray is prosecuting the matter.
